From: "d.v.a at ngs dot ru" <gcc-bugzilla@gcc.gnu.org> To: gcc-bugs@gcc.gnu.org Subject: [Bug libstdc++/60936] New: Binary code bloat with std::string Date: Wed, 23 Apr 2014 11:10:00 -0000 [thread overview] Message-ID: <bug-60936-4@http.g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/> (raw) http://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=60936 Bug ID: 60936 Summary: Binary code bloat with std::string Product: gcc Version: 4.9.0 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: P3 Component: libstdc++ Assignee: unassigned at gcc dot gnu.org Reporter: d.v.a at ngs dot ru Test program: #include<string> int hello() { std::string st("abc"); return st.length(); } Build: $ g++ -shared -fPIC -static-libgcc -static-libstdc++ -Wl,-s -o $@ $? Sizes of result: gcc-4_7-string.so: 171744 gcc-4_8-string.so: 185808 gcc-4_9-string.so: 635960
